1. My wife's business is WAY down
but then again, so is the industry. My wife makes custom jewelry in the $20-100 range. We were down about 35% last year. Friends of mine in the fine jewelry business said they were ALL down between 20-40% this year.

I just engineered a corporate takeover, so now I am part of the ownership world as well. We are starting well, but time will tell when we launch our new product in the next few weeks.
